What's The Definition Of Unsyllabic?
[adj] not forming a syllable or the nucleus of a syllable; (of a consonant sound) accompanied in the same syllable by a vowel sound as the `n' in `botany' when pronounced `botny'; (of a vowel sound) dominated by other vowel sounds in a syllable; i.e. being the second vowel in a falling diphthong as the `i' in `oi'
